TEMPE, Ariz. â€" Authorities say a man-made lake near Phoenix will likely lose two-thirds to three-fourths of its water after a rubberized dam burst and sent thousands of gallons of water gushing downstream into a dry river bed.
The 16-foot-high section of the dam on Tempe Town Lake near Arizona State University's campus broke open at about 10 p.m. Tuesday. There were no immediate reports of any injuries and authorities said no structures were in immediate danger.
Tempe spokeswoman Kris Baxter-Ging says its unclear how the rubber dam burst, but she says workers are speeding up an already under way effort to replace the dam's bladders.
She says police and fire were working to secure area around the lake, which can hold up to 1 billion gallons of water.
